In a recent report by The Guardian, it is reported that Prince Harry and Meghan Markle had to wait for almost half a year for their children’s official documents to be issued after they filled in Prince Archie and Princess Lilibet’s last names as Sussex. Prince Harry was afraid that the passports were "being blocked with a string of excuses over the course of five months." An inside source near the couple has shared with the outlet that “there was clear reluctance to issue passports for the kids” from the side of the Royal Palace.

The insider has also shared the report that King Charles did not want his grandchildren, Prince Archie and Princess Lilibet, “to carry the titles, most of all the HRH, and the British passports,” which, once created, would become the only legal proof of their names. It was only after the Sussexes' legal team sent a strict letter threatening to file a data subject access request that the passports were issued.
